Dined here at a local Italian pizza restaurant and ordered the DOP pizza; a classic with San Marzano tomato sauce, fresh buffalo mozzarella, basil and EVO oil. The base was very thin but was still able to hold the toppings and the crust was soft with a pleasant chew to it. Tomato was sweet with a hint of tartness, and each slice had a large full bite of buffalo mozzarella; very tasty. Also had the Nutella calzone which was cooked well with enough oozing Nutella to go with the soft pizza dough crust; and the vanilla bean gelato paired well to balance the richness of the Nutella. Overall a delicious pizza; crust was not tough even till the last piece. Service was also great.

Seating
There's outdoor seating available in the front, more quiet and private compared to inside the restaurant, there's also a covered outdoor area in the back of the restaurant but that area wasn't being used so can't comment what the experience will be there. Inside there's multiple seating available, catering to couples to families.
Food
I'm going to just come out and say this place makes the best pizza in Melbourne - period. Tried other award-winning pizza restaurants and have always left wanting more. The pizza here are made with high-quality ingredients, the star of the show here is definitely the pizza base. In my opinion, it strikes a perfect balance between crispy, airy and slightly chewy crust. I know most people don't rate pizza based on the base but like a good house, you need a solid foundation.
If you're having leftover pizza, recommend reheating it in the oven and if you have a cast-iron pan, highly recommend reheating the pizza on the cast iron pan first and putting it in the oven to finish, your taste buds will thank you.
Antipasti items for the one that we've tried were really good, highly recommend the Focaccia, Piccolo Antipasto, Amalfi Coast Anchovies to share. You can tell all the items sourced were from quality ingredients and suppliers.
Drinks
Great selection of Italian wine and beer available to enjoy, all displayed in front of the restaurant which gives you a bit of time to explore while you wait for your table. I believe most of the wines are available to take away along with some of the fine Italian goods you can takeaway, i.e. Pasta, salt, olive oil, etc.
